Cummins QSM11-C350 Engine for Belaz MOAZ-75041 Cross-Country Dump Truck

As the main means of transportation in open-pit mines, the belaz MOAZ-75041 mine car can adapt to the harsh mining conditions in deep pits. The vehicle has a payload capacity of 27 MT and is mainly powered by a Cummins QSM11-C350 engine with a main power of 261 kW and a torque of 1800 RPM.

General Infomation of XCEX QSM11-C350A Industrial Engine

rated PowerQSM11-C350AEmission StandardEuro III
Curve&DatasheetFR20017Displacement10.8 L
Compression Ratio16.3 : 1Packing Size(L * W * H)N/A
No. Of Cylinders6 Cylinders, in LineWet WeightN/A
Fuel SystemCelect ElectronicCPL Code Revision8543
AspirationTurbocharged & Air-Air IntercoolerConfigurationD353020CX03
Rated Power350 HP @ 2100 RPMPeak Torque1776 N.m @ 1400 RPM

Performance Data of XCEX QSM11-C350A Industrial Engine

Max. Low Idle Speed1200 RPM
Min. Low Idle Speed600 RPM
Min. Engine Speed for Full Load Sustained Operation1600 RPM

Performance Data Rated Power of XCEX QSM11-C350A Industrial Engine

Rated PowerMax. PowerTorque Peak
Engine Speed2100 RPM1800 RPM1400 RPM
Output Power350 HP,261 kW385 HP ,287 kW349 HP,260 kW
Torque875 lb-ft,1,186 N.m1,123 lb-ft ,1,523 N.m1,310 lb-ft ,1,776 N.m
Friction Horsepower61 HP,46 kW45 HP,33 kW28 HP, 21 kW
Intake Manifold Pressure52 in-Hg ,174 kPa53 in-Hg ,180 kPa51 in-Hg ,173 kPa
Turbo Comp. Outlet Pressure55 in-Hg ,186 kPa56 in-Hg ,189 kPa53 in-Hg ,178 kPa
Turbo Comp. Outlet Temperature337 deg F,169 deg C334 deg F, 168 deg C342 deg F, 172 deg C
Inlet Air Flow949 ft3/min ,448 L/s852 ft3/min ,402 L/s674 ft3/min, 318 L/s
Charge Air Flow68 lb/min ,31 kg/min63 lb/min, 28 kg/min49 lb/min, 22 kg/min
Exhaust Gas Flow2,408 ft3/min ,1,136 L/s2,318 ft3/min ,1,094 L/s1,933 ft3/min ,912 L/s
Exhaust Gas Temperature950 deg F, 510 deg C1,008 deg F, 542 deg C1,104 deg F, 596 deg C
Max. Fuel Flow to Pump434 lb/hr ,197 kg/hr364 lb/hr ,165 kg/hr255 lb/hr ,116 kg/hr
Heat Rejection to Coolant5,880 BTU/min, 103.4 kW6,078 BTU/min, 106.88 kW5,830 BTU/min,102.52 kW
Heat Rejection to Fuel235 BTU/min ,4.13 kW235 BTU/min ,4.13 kW233 BTU/min, 4.1 kW
Heat Rejection to Ambient1,338 BTU/min ,23.53 kW1,518 BTU/min, 26.69 kW1,380 BTU/min, 24.27 kW
Heat Rejection to Exhaust15,160 BTU/min ,266.58 kW14,870 BTU/min ,261.48 kW13,270 BTU/min,233.34 kW
Steady State Smoke1.06 Bosch0.6Bosch0.3 Bosch
